Output 84434069c2691b609ba0681d3c12b758b1a8f1ef6dfce03f10757a50b7d95440:0

value
39175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7badb92dc19210c2087a8d18bb557a938218195b OP_EQUAL
address
3Cxy9ec4r5vsdj5JHfzRT8Xz9n9wC8Cfxk
transaction
84434069c2691b609ba0681d3c12b758b1a8f1ef6dfce03f10757a50b7d95440
spent
true